    wondering which race will be better for my 4th class enchanter

    as i understood till now, it will be only race skills difference, so:


    dark elf shadow sense will be removed.

    sharpness: physical / magical critical damage increased by 208. +
    wind blessing: wind attack/defense +10.

    dark presence: str / int increased at night by 1.

    siphon life: vr +1%. +
    acceleration: removes all debuffs on self and increases spd. the caster also cannot be targeted for a certain time.


    versus

    orc orc lose toughness and iron body.

    fire blessing: fire attack/defense +10.

    energetic: hp regen +3.0.

    undying will: trigger - when hp falls below 20% the orc becomes invulnerable for 3 seconds, cooldown 5 min. +
    savage: skill - attack speed increased by 17%, defense decreased by 15%. +

    vote and write your opinion.

    p.s. +* is my opinion advantages of each race

    all of the chanter skills are useable with simple 1h blunt.
    prepare to throw away your old gear, because lowr weapon is obtainable via teredor instance (120 items needed, 20 items per day via quest). sa crystal is also obtainable via quest (takes 4 days) +19 rgem (1 200 000 each, mammon sells them). only heavily oed old gear can compete with that.
    anyways, no one will care if you use whatever weapon, chanter doesn`t do noticeable damage, his/her only focus is debuff. debuffs are mostly non-magic, so they land even with noob weapon.
    soa daily quest can give random lowr to topr weapon as a reward, but it is really random. though i`ve seen people getting apoc weapons twice in a row..

    as to armor, you`d really want rgrade unless you have 6++ vesper set, chanter needs to be close to mobs to debuff, he catches all kinds of aggro+mass damage. lowr armor is easily obtainable, if you start exping near de village at about lvl83, when you are lvl85, you`ll have all the parts of armor minus breastplate and gaiters. they are obtainable via solo instance in soa (time needed to get them depends on how well you fare in killing mobs there, on average killrate i`d say a weak each item if you do instance once a day; if you do it 2-3 times a day, you`ll get both in less then a week). that is, if you don`t want to depend on drop in other 85+ locations and/or const party distribution.
